Olbas Oil Inhalant Decongestant – 12ml
Olbas Oil Inhalant Decongestant is a blend of essential plant oils used to relieve nasal and bronchial congestion caused by colds, flu, sinusitis, allergies, and hay fever. It can also be applied to the skin to help ease muscular aches and pains.
⸻
How It Works
Olbas Oil contains a combination of essential oils — including eucalyptus, peppermint, and cajuput — that produce a cooling, menthol-like vapour when inhaled. This vapour helps to open up the airways, soothe irritated nasal passages, and make breathing feel easier. When applied to the skin, the oils provide a warming sensation that can help to relieve mild muscular pain.

Directions for Use
Inhalation from a tissue (adults and children over 12): Place 2–3 drops onto a tissue and inhale as needed.
Steam inhalation (adults and children over 12): Add 2–3 drops to a bowl of hot water. Place a towel over your head and the bowl, and inhale the vapour for up to 10 minutes. Keep your eyes closed during steam inhalation.
Topical use — muscular relief (adults and children over 12): Apply a few drops to the affected area and massage gently into the skin. Do not apply near the face or broken skin.
Children aged 3 months to 12 years: For inhalation from a tissue only — place 2–3 drops onto a tissue near (not directly on or under) the child’s nose. Do not use steam inhalation in children under 12. Do not use in children under 3 months of age.
Always read the patient information leaflet before use. If you are unsure about the correct dose, speak to your PillSorted pharmacist.

Active Ingredients
• Eucalyptus Oil 35.45% w/w
• Levomenthol 4.14% w/w
• Cajuput Oil 18.50% w/w
• Clove Oil 0.10% w/w
• Juniper Berry Oil 2.70% w/w
• Peppermint Oil 35.45% w/w
• Wintergreen Oil 3.66% w/w

Possible Side Effects
• Skin irritation or redness at the site of application
• Allergic skin reactions such as rash or itching
• Eye irritation if vapour or oil comes into contact with the eyes
• Sneezing or mild irritation of the nose or throat on inhalation
• Rarely, hypersensitivity reactions
If you experience any serious side effects, stop taking this medicine and seek medical advice immediately.
⸻
Who Should Not Take This Medicine
• Children under 3 months of age
• Anyone with a known allergy to any of the essential oil ingredients
• Do not apply to broken, damaged, or inflamed skin
• Do not apply near the eyes, mouth, or other sensitive areas
• Do not use steam inhalation in children under 12 years of age
• Do not use internally (do not swallow)

Interactions
Olbas Oil is applied externally or inhaled, so significant drug interactions are unlikely when used as directed. However, if you are using other topical products on the same area of skin, avoid applying them at the same time as this may cause irritation. Tell your PillSorted pharmacist or doctor about all medicines you are currently taking, including herbal remedies and supplements.
⸻
Pregnancy and Breastfeeding
The safety of Olbas Oil during pregnancy and breastfeeding has not been fully established. Some of the essential oils contained in this product may not be suitable for use during pregnancy or whilst breastfeeding. Speak to your doctor or PillSorted pharmacist before use if you are pregnant, trying to conceive, or breastfeeding.
⸻
Alcohol
There is no known interaction between Olbas Oil and alcohol when used as directed for inhalation or topical application. As this product is not taken orally, alcohol is unlikely to affect how it works.
⸻
Driving and Operating Machinery
Olbas Oil is not known to cause drowsiness and is unlikely to affect your ability to drive or operate machinery. However, if you experience any unexpected dizziness or discomfort after use, avoid driving until you feel well.
⸻
Storage
Store below 25°C in a dry place, away from direct sunlight and heat sources. Keep the cap tightly closed when not in use to prevent evaporation of the essential oils. Keep out of sight and reach of children. Do not use after the expiry date shown on the packaging.
